The Psychological Draw of Risk and Reward
At the heart of adventure fandom lies a complex interplay of psychological factors. The allure of risk, when managed and understood, can lead to heightened states of consciousness and a profound sense of being alive. This isn’t recklessness; it’s a calculated embrace of the unknown, where preparedness and skill mitigate potential dangers. The reward isn’t just the completion of the activity, but the mental fortitude and confidence gained from facing and conquering fear.
The experience of flow, a state of complete immersion and focus, is frequently reported by adventure enthusiasts. In this state, time seems to warp, and performance becomes almost effortless, driven by instinct and honed skill. This psychological payoff is a significant driver, offering a potent antidote to the stresses and distractions of everyday life. It’s a way to achieve a pure, unadulterated engagement with the present moment.
